[Asia Economy Honam Reporting Headquarters Reporter Park Jin-hyung] The police have seized and searched the Gwangsan District Office in connection with allegations of misconduct involving current and former public officials related to the illegal operation of a quarry.
The Anti-Corruption Economic Crime Investigation Unit of the Gwangju Police Agency executed a search warrant at the Gwangsan District Office on the 14th.
The police launched an investigation based on suspicions that illegal business activities were conducted under the tacit approval of the responsible local government from 2011, when the permit expired, until the reauthorization in 2014 at a quarry in Gwangsan District.
Having uncovered additional allegations of misconduct involving current and former public officials, the police have begun securing testimonies from related parties and collecting evidence such as documents.
